Abstract
We consider the results of the statistical analysis using the methods of the principal components and canonical coherences applied to the processing of long (1986–2005) time series of hydrogeochemical observations at the flowing wells and springs in Kamchatka. The time-frequency diagrams of the evolution of informative statistics characterizing the collective behavior of multidimensional hydrogeochemical time series are constructed, and the time intervals and frequency bands where the synchronization signals (Lyubushin, 2007) appear are identified. The features of their occurrence are analyzed in comparison to the strong (Mw = 6.6–7.8) local earthquakes. It is found that such signals in the measurements of some multidimensional time series can arise both before and after earthquakes, i.e. these signals have a precursory (P2) and postseismic (P3) character.
